SLC Olympic cauldron to be lit next week to celebrate 20th anniversary of 2002 Winter games List of public events and activities:

SALT LAKE CITY — The Olympic cauldron will be relit next week to celebrate the 20th anniversary of Salt Lake City hosting the 2002 Winter Olympics and Paralympics, and various events are also planned in different areas across the state over the next few months.

A formal torch lighting ceremony will be held outside Rice-Eccles Stadium Tuesday from 6:15 to 6:30 p.m. Governor Spencer Cox and Mayor Erin Mendenhall will speak, as well as Fraser Bullock, the president of the Salt Lake City-Utah Committee for the Games. The cauldron will remain lit through Saturday of next week.The Utah Olympic Legacy Foundation also announced events planned in the Salt Lake area, Park City, Heber Valley, Ogden, and Utah County.

The full list of events is below. More information on each event can be found on the foundation's website.April 14, 2022: Athlete Homecoming Celebration at Governor’s Utah State of Sport Awards.
